/*
 * File system states
 */
#define	EXT2_VALID_FS			0x0001	/* Unmounted cleanly */
#define	EXT2_ERROR_FS			0x0002	/* Errors detected */

/*
 * Mount flags
 */
#define EXT2_MOUNT_CHECK_NORMAL		0x0001	/* Do some more checks */
#define EXT2_MOUNT_CHECK_STRICT		0x0002	/* Do again more checks */
#define EXT2_MOUNT_CHECK		(EXT2_MOUNT_CHECK_NORMAL | \
					 EXT2_MOUNT_CHECK_STRICT)
#define EXT2_MOUNT_GRPID		0x0004	/* Create files with directory's group */
#define EXT2_MOUNT_DEBUG		0x0008	/* Some debugging messages */
#define EXT2_MOUNT_ERRORS_CONT		0x0010	/* Continue on errors */
#define EXT2_MOUNT_ERRORS_RO		0x0020	/* Remount fs ro on errors */
#define EXT2_MOUNT_ERRORS_PANIC		0x0040	/* Panic on errors */
#define EXT2_MOUNT_MINIX_DF		0x0080	/* Mimics the Minix statfs */
#define EXT2_MOUNT_NO_ATIME		0x0100  /* Don't update the atime */

#define clear_opt(o, opt)		o &= ~EXT2_MOUNT_##opt
#define set_opt(o, opt)			o |= EXT2_MOUNT_##opt
#define test_opt(sb, opt)		((sb)->u.ext2_sb.s_mount_opt & \
					 EXT2_MOUNT_##opt)
/*
 * Maximal mount counts between two filesystem checks
 */
#define EXT2_DFL_MAX_MNT_COUNT		20	/* Allow 20 mounts */
#define EXT2_DFL_CHECKINTERVAL		0	/* Don't use interval check */

/*
 * Behaviour when detecting errors
 */
#define EXT2_ERRORS_CONTINUE		1	/* Continue execution */
#define EXT2_ERRORS_RO			2	/* Remount fs read-only */
#define EXT2_ERRORS_PANIC		3	/* Panic */
#define EXT2_ERRORS_DEFAULT		EXT2_ERRORS_CONTINUE

/*
 * Structure of the super block
 */
struct ext2_super_block {
	__u32	s_inodes_count;		/* Inodes count */
	__u32	s_blocks_count;		/* Blocks count */
	__u32	s_r_blocks_count;	/* Reserved blocks count */
	__u32	s_free_blocks_count;	/* Free blocks count */
	__u32	s_free_inodes_count;	/* Free inodes count */
	__u32	s_first_data_block;	/* First Data Block */
	__u32	s_log_block_size;	/* Block size */
	__s32	s_log_frag_size;	/* Fragment size */
	__u32	s_blocks_per_group;	/* # Blocks per group */
	__u32	s_frags_per_group;	/* # Fragments per group */
	__u32	s_inodes_per_group;	/* # Inodes per group */
	__u32	s_mtime;		/* Mount time */
	__u32	s_wtime;		/* Write time */
	__u16	s_mnt_count;		/* Mount count */
	__s16	s_max_mnt_count;	/* Maximal mount count */
	__u16	s_magic;		/* Magic signature */
	__u16	s_state;		/* File system state */
	__u16	s_errors;		/* Behaviour when detecting errors */
	__u16	s_minor_rev_level; 	/* minor revision level */
	__u32	s_lastcheck;		/* time of last check */
	__u32	s_checkinterval;	/* max. time between checks */
	__u32	s_creator_os;		/* OS */
	__u32	s_rev_level;		/* Revision level */
	__u16	s_def_resuid;		/* Default uid for reserved blocks */
	__u16	s_def_resgid;		/* Default gid for reserved blocks */
	/*
	 * These fields are for EXT2_DYNAMIC_REV superblocks only.
	 *
	 * Note: the difference between the compatible feature set and
	 * the incompatible feature set is that if there is a bit set
	 * in the incompatible feature set that the kernel doesn't
	 * know about, it should refuse to mount the filesystem.
	 * 
	 * e2fsck's requirements are more strict; if it doesn't know
	 * about a feature in either the compatible or incompatible
	 * feature set, it must abort and not try to meddle with
	 * things it doesn't understand...
	 */
	__u32	s_first_ino; 		/* First non-reserved inode */
	__u16   s_inode_size; 		/* size of inode structure */
	__u16	s_block_group_nr; 	/* block group # of this superblock */
	__u32	s_feature_compat; 	/* compatible feature set */
	__u32	s_feature_incompat; 	/* incompatible feature set */
	__u32	s_feature_ro_compat; 	/* readonly-compatible feature set */
	__u32	s_reserved[230];	/* Padding to the end of the block */
};

/*
 * Codes for operating systems
 */
#define EXT2_OS_LINUX		0
#define EXT2_OS_HURD		1
#define EXT2_OS_MASIX		2
#define EXT2_OS_FREEBSD		3
#define EXT2_OS_LITES		4

/*
 * Revision levels
 */
#define EXT2_GOOD_OLD_REV	0	/* The good old (original) format */
#define EXT2_DYNAMIC_REV	1 	/* V2 format w/ dynamic inode sizes */

#define EXT2_CURRENT_REV	EXT2_GOOD_OLD_REV
#define EXT2_MAX_SUPP_REV	EXT2_DYNAMIC_REV

#define EXT2_GOOD_OLD_INODE_SIZE 128

/*
 * Default values for user and/or group using reserved blocks
 */
#define	EXT2_DEF_RESUID		0
#define	EXT2_DEF_RESGID		0

/*
 * Structure of a directory entry
 */
#define EXT2_NAME_LEN 255

struct ext2_dir_entry {
	__u32	inode;			/* Inode number */
	__u16	rec_len;		/* Directory entry length */
	__u16	name_len;		/* Name length */
	char	name[EXT2_NAME_LEN];	/* File name */
};

/*
 * EXT2_DIR_PAD defines the directory entries boundaries
 *
 * NOTE: It must be a multiple of 4
 */
#define EXT2_DIR_PAD		 	4
#define EXT2_DIR_ROUND 			(EXT2_DIR_PAD - 1)
#define EXT2_DIR_REC_LEN(name_len)	(((name_len) + 8 + EXT2_DIR_ROUND) & \
					 ~EXT2_DIR_ROUND)

/*
 * Feature set definitions --- none are defined as of now
 */
#define EXT2_FEATURE_COMPAT_SUPP	0
#define EXT2_FEATURE_INCOMPAT_SUPP	0
#define EXT2_FEATURE_RO_COMPAT_SUPP	0

#ifdef __KERNEL__
/*
 * Function prototypes
 */

/*
 * Ok, these declarations are also in <linux/kernel.h> but none of the
 * ext2 source programs needs to include it so they are duplicated here.
 */
# define NORET_TYPE    /**/
# define ATTRIB_NORET  __attribute__((noreturn))
# define NORET_AND     noreturn,

/* acl.c */
extern int ext2_permission (struct inode *, int);

/* balloc.c */
extern int ext2_new_block (const struct inode *, unsigned long,
			   __u32 *, __u32 *, int *);
extern void ext2_free_blocks (const struct inode *, unsigned long,
			      unsigned long);
extern unsigned long ext2_count_free_blocks (struct super_block *);
extern void ext2_check_blocks_bitmap (struct super_block *);

/* bitmap.c */
extern unsigned long ext2_count_free (struct buffer_head *, unsigned);

/* dir.c */
extern int ext2_check_dir_entry (const char *, struct inode *,
				 struct ext2_dir_entry *, struct buffer_head *,
				 unsigned long);

/* file.c */
extern int ext2_read (struct inode *, struct file *, char *, int);
extern int ext2_write (struct inode *, struct file *, char *, int);

/* fsync.c */
extern int ext2_sync_file (struct inode *, struct file *);

/* ialloc.c */
extern struct inode * ext2_new_inode (const struct inode *, int, int *);
extern void ext2_free_inode (struct inode *);
extern unsigned long ext2_count_free_inodes (struct super_block *);
extern void ext2_check_inodes_bitmap (struct super_block *);

/* inode.c */
extern int ext2_bmap (struct inode *, int);

extern struct buffer_head * ext2_getblk (struct inode *, long, int, int *);
extern struct buffer_head * ext2_bread (struct inode *, int, int, int *);

extern int ext2_getcluster (struct inode * inode, long block);
extern void ext2_read_inode (struct inode *);
extern void ext2_write_inode (struct inode *);
extern void ext2_put_inode (struct inode *);
extern int ext2_sync_inode (struct inode *);
extern void ext2_discard_prealloc (struct inode *);

/* ioctl.c */
extern int ext2_ioctl (struct inode *, struct file *, unsigned int,
		       unsigned long);

/* namei.c */
extern void ext2_release (struct inode *, struct file *);
extern int ext2_lookup (struct inode *,const char *, int, struct inode **);
extern int ext2_create (struct inode *,const char *, int, int,
			struct inode **);
extern int ext2_mkdir (struct inode *, const char *, int, int);
extern int ext2_rmdir (struct inode *, const char *, int);
extern int ext2_unlink (struct inode *, const char *, int);
extern int ext2_symlink (struct inode *, const char *, int, const char *);
extern int ext2_link (struct inode *, struct inode *, const char *, int);
extern int ext2_mknod (struct inode *, const char *, int, int, int);
extern int ext2_rename (struct inode *, const char *, int,
			struct inode *, const char *, int, int);

/* super.c */
extern void ext2_error (struct super_block *, const char *, const char *, ...)
	__attribute__ ((format (printf, 3, 4)));
extern NORET_TYPE void ext2_panic (struct super_block *, const char *,
				   const char *, ...)
	__attribute__ ((NORET_AND format (printf, 3, 4)));
extern void ext2_warning (struct super_block *, const char *, const char *, ...)
	__attribute__ ((format (printf, 3, 4)));
extern void ext2_put_super (struct super_block *);
extern void ext2_write_super (struct super_block *);
extern int ext2_remount (struct super_block *, int *, char *);
extern struct super_block * ext2_read_super (struct super_block *,void *,int);
extern int init_ext2_fs(void);
extern void ext2_statfs (struct super_block *, struct statfs *, int);

/* truncate.c */
extern void ext2_truncate (struct inode *);

/*
 * Inodes and files operations
 */

/* dir.c */
extern struct inode_operations ext2_dir_inode_operations;

/* file.c */
extern struct inode_operations ext2_file_inode_operations;

/* symlink.c */
extern struct inode_operations ext2_symlink_inode_operations;

#endif	/* __KERNEL__ */

#endif	/* _LINUX_EXT2_FS_H */
